If you’re a Vascular Sonographer curious about Travel job trends in Salem, MA, AMN Healthcare has successfully filled 8 similar positions in the area, providing insight into the opportunities you could expect. These previously filled roles offered competitive pay, with an average weekly rate of $2,057 and a range from $1,677 to $2,635 per week, showcasing the strong earning potential for professionals in this field.
Positions were located in key zip codes, including 01970. These placements reflect the high demand for skilled Vascular Sonographers in Salem’s thriving healthcare landscape. As a Sonographer specializing in vascular imaging in Salem, Massachusetts, you will find a variety of work environments and opportunities to enhance your career. In this vibrant coastal city, renowned for its historic charm and commitment to healthcare, you can expect to work in diverse settings, including hospitals, outpatient clinics, and diagnostic imaging centers. Your responsibilities will include performing non-invasive ultrasound examinations to assess the vascular system, aiding in the diagnosis of conditions such as deep vein thrombosis, arterial blockages, and varicose veins. Salem’s healthcare facilities are equipped with advanced technologies, offering a collaborative atmosphere where you will work alongside a multidisciplinary team of physicians and healthcare professionals. This dynamic role not only allows you to apply your technical skills but also to positively impact patient outcomes by ensuring accurate assessments and contributing to effective treatment plans.

Candidates for a Vascular Sonography travel job in Salem, Massachusetts typically need a registered vascular technologist (RVT) certification and proficiency in performing vascular ultrasound studies. Preferred experience includes previous travel assignments and familiarity with a variety of ultrasound equipment and techniques.
Vascular Sonography travel jobs in Salem, Massachusetts, are typically found in hospitals, outpatient imaging centers, and sometimes specialized clinics focusing on vascular health. These facilities often seek qualified professionals to assist with diagnostic imaging and evaluation of vascular disorders in a dynamic healthcare environment.
For Vascular Sonography Travel jobs in Salem, MA, typical contract durations range from 13 weeks. These flexible contract lengths allow you to choose an assignment that best fits your career goals and lifestyle preferences.
